Hi Guys,

Its that time again i see google has updated my sites Page Rank from 2 to 4 on the home page but looking through my site i see some changes to my other pages. My home page got a PR4 some of my services pages got PR2-3 and my articles pages got a PR3.

Is it possible to manipulate PR by internal linking? Any tips on internal linking?

Your thoughts please

Internal linking, from my experience, is a good way of distributing link-juice and in turn PR between pages. On any website that I create, I always do deep internal linking, so have links on the first page that link to pages deep within the website. Not only is it a good way to offer up important information to the user, it is good SEO practice
